Released in 2013, Chennai Express is a landmark action-comedy film in Indian cinema that successfully blended the high-octane style of director Rohit Shetty with the global appeal of superstar Shah Rukh Khan. The film's narrative centers on Rahul (Shah Rukh Khan), a 40-year-old bachelor whose journey to immerse his grandfather's ashes in Rameshwaram takes an unexpected turn when he boards the eponymous train. Plot and Themes
The story follows Rahul's accidental encounter with Meenamma (Deepika Padukone), the daughter of a powerful local don in Tamil Nadu. This meeting thrusts Rahul into a series of comedic yet dangerous adventures in the exuberant lands of South India.
Cultural Collision: A significant portion of the film's humor and conflict arises from the language barrier and cultural differences between the North Indian protagonist and the South Indian setting.
Character Growth: While initially focused on self-preservation, Rahul eventually discovers the depth of true love and the importance of personal sacrifice. Critical and Commercial Impact
Box Office Success: Chennai Express was a massive commercial hit, becoming one of the highest-grossing Indian films of its time with global collections exceeding ₹400 crore.
Technical Reception: Critics often highlighted the film's vibrant cinematography and Rohit Shetty's signature large-scale action sequences. However, some reviewers noted that the film relied heavily on "buffoonery" and was primarily designed for loyal fans of the lead stars.

Chennai Express is a high-octane blend of action, romance, and slapstick comedy that serves as a colorful love letter to South Indian culture through a Bollywood lens. Directed by Rohit Shetty, the film broke numerous box office records upon its release in 2013, solidifying Shah Rukh Khan’s "King Khan" status for a new decade. 🚂 The Plot
The story follows Rahul (Shah Rukh Khan), a 40-year-old bachelor from Mumbai who embarks on a journey to Rameshwaram to immerse his late grandfather’s ashes. His plans for a secret vacation in Goa are derailed when he helps a girl, Meenamma (Deepika Padukone), and her pursuers board the "Chennai Express." He quickly realizes he has inadvertently helped the daughter of a powerful local don escape an arranged marriage, thrusting him into a chaotic adventure across the vibrant landscapes of Tamil Nadu. 🌟 Key Highlights
Deepika Padukone’s Performance: Often cited as the heart of the film, Deepika’s comedic timing and "Meenamma" accent became iconic.
Visual Splendor: Shot beautifully in locations like Munnar, the film offers stunning cinematography that captures the lush greenery and majestic waterfalls of the South.
Music and Score: The soundtrack by Vishal-Shekhar is infectious, featuring hits like "Lungi Dance" (a tribute to Rajinikanth) and the soulful "Titli."

Released in 2013, Chennai Express is a quintessential Bollywood "masala" entertainer directed by Rohit Shetty. The film follows Rahul (Shah Rukh Khan), a 40-year-old businessman from Mumbai who accidentally boards the namesake train to Rameshwaram, only to become entangled with Meenamma (Deepika Padukone), the daughter of a powerful Tamil don. Cinematic Performance
The film is widely praised for the electric chemistry between Shah Rukh Khan and Deepika Padukone.
Deepika Padukone: Most reviewers agree this was a career-defining performance; she received significant acclaim for her comedic timing and her portrayal of a Tamil girl, including her distinctive "bokwas" dialogues and thick South Indian accent.
Shah Rukh Khan: Critics highlighted his "victim act" and return to form as a romantic-comedy lead, though some felt he was occasionally overshadowed by Padukone’s performance. Artistic and Visual Style

Chennai Express (2013) is a blockbuster Bollywood action-comedy directed by Rohit Shetty , featuring the iconic pairing of Shah Rukh Khan Deepika Padukone
. The film is celebrated as a "masala" entertainer, blending high-octane action, vibrant romance, and slapstick humor against the picturesque backdrop of South India. Plot Summary The story follows Rahul Mithaiwala
(Shah Rukh Khan), a 40-year-old bachelor from Mumbai whose life takes an unexpected turn while attempting to fulfill his late grandfather's last wish: immersing his ashes in the holy waters of Rameswaram . After boarding the Chennai Express, he helps Meenalochni "Meenamma" Azhagusundaram
(Deepika Padukone) and her cousins board the moving train, only to realize she is the daughter of a powerful Tamil don fleeing an arranged marriage. Rahul soon finds himself entangled in a dangerous but hilarious cultural clash between North and South India. Key Highlights Star Power:
The film marked the second collaboration between Khan and Padukone after Om Shanti Om
, showcasing electric chemistry and Padukone’s acclaimed performance as the spirited Meenamma. Musical Success: The soundtrack by Vishal-Shekhar
became a cultural phenomenon, featuring chartbusters like the Rajinikanth tribute "Lungi Dance" , the romantic melody , and the high-energy "1 2 3 4 Get on the Dance Floor" Box Office Records:
Upon its release, it became the fastest film to cross the ₹1 billion mark in India and eventually surpassed
to become the highest-grossing Bollywood film worldwide at that time.
